Biomedical Technician Jobs in Chapel Hill, TN

A Biomedical Technician, also known as a Biomedical Equipment Technician (BMET), plays a critical role in the biotechnology industry by maintaining, repairing, and calibrating the machinery and equipment used in healthcare facilities. In this role, technicians troubleshoot equipment issues, perform preventative maintenance, and ensure that machines are properly calibrated for accurate test results. Primarily, they work on complex devices like defibrillators, heart monitors, medical imaging equipment (MRI and X-ray machines), voice-controlled operating tables, and electric wheelchairs.

Biomedical Technicians should possess a deep understanding of electronics and computer systems, as well as strong problem-solving skills. They should be able to read and understand technical manuals, work under pressure, and communicate effectively with healthcare personnel. A degree in biomedical technology or engineering is typically required, along with certifications like the Certified Biomedical Equipment Technician (CBET) or Certified Laboratory Equipment Specialist (CLES). Prior to becoming a Biomedical Technician, individuals often gain experience in roles such as a Biomedical Equipment Support Specialist, Medical Equipment Repairer, or Biomedical Engineer.
